SAUCES

Chocolate Sauce

1 Tablespoonful of Butter 1 Cupful of Sugar
2 Tablespoonfuls of 4 Tablespoonfuls of Boil-
Cocoa ing Water

Put the butter into an agate dish on the stove; when melted, stir in the cocoa and sugar dry; add boiling water and stir until smooth. Add vanilla to taste.

Cold Sauce

Cream together one-half cupful of butter and one and one-half cupfuls of sugar. Grate a little nutmeg over the top.

Cranberry Sauce

Pick over and wash one quart of cranberries; cover with cold water and cook until tender. Remove from the fire, rub through a colander and sweeten to taste.
